Location: Peterborough
Length of Contract: 6 months
Work Pattern: Mondays 13.00-21.00 & Wednesdays 13.00-21.00
Hourly rate: Competitive
Role Summary: Deliver Occupational Health Physiotherapy services focused on early return to work. This includes functional assessments, evidence-based treatment, and workplace assessments.
Key Responsibilities:
- Provide accurate clinical assessment, diagnosis, and treatment (in-person & remote).
- Advise management on fitness to work and any necessary adjustments.
- Adhere to national clinical standards for rehabilitation.
Requirements:
- Must live near the area
- Must have a full driving license and access to a vehicle
- Physiotherapy qualification
- CSP member & HCPC registered
- Experience or interest in Occupational Health.
